The Risk Management (RM) Specialist supports the organization's enterprise risk, insurance, and business continuity programs by maintaining risk documentation, processing certificates of insurance, assisting with coordination of insurance activities, supporting claims management processes, and assisting with risk analysis and reporting. This role plays an important part in helping the organization identify, document, and mitigate operational and financial risks across the enterprise.

TheRisk Management Specialist collaborates with internal departments such as Finance, Legal, Human Resources, Operations, and Security, as well as external partners including insurance brokers and service providers. In addition to managing insurance-related documentation and processes, the role contributes to risk assessments, corporate security initiatives, and business continuity planning activities to ensure the organization is prepared to manage operational disruptions and evolving business risks.

This position provides exposure to a broad range of enterprise risk management activities and offers opportunities to participate in strategic initiatives, process improvements, and cross-functional projects that strengthen the organization's overall risk posture.

Responsibilities
Insurance Program Administration
  • Maintain and update documentation for the organization's insurance programs, including policies, program summaries, coverage documentation, and related records.
  • Assist with the preparation and organization of materials required for annual insurance renewals and policy placements.
  • Support coordination with insurance brokers and carriers to ensure accurate and timely program administration.
  • Assist with the allocation of insurance expenses to operating companies and business units.
  • Maintain detailed records of insurance coverage and assist internal stakeholders with insurance-related inquiries.

Certificates of Insurance & Vendor Risk Documentation

  • Issue and manage Certificates of Insurance for customers, vendors, and partners.
  • Maintain documentation related to vendor insurance requirements and compliance.
  • Coordinate with internal teams and external partners to ensure accurate and timely documentation of coverage requirements.

Claims Management Support

  • Assist with the administration and documentation of first- and third-party insurance claims.
  • Coordinate claims-related communication among internal departments such as Accounting, Legal, Human Resources, and Operations.
  • Track claims activity and support documentation and reporting required for TPA, insurance carriers, and internal leadership.

Captive Insurance & Risk Financing Support

  • Support administrative activities related to the organization's captive insurance company.
  • Assist with the calculation and issuance of captive insurance premiums.
  • Maintain records and documentation related to captive insurance activities.

Business Continuity & Operational Resilience

  • Assist with administration of the organization's Business Continuity Program.
  • Coordinate scheduling of business continuity exercises and support testing activities.
  • Maintain and update business continuity documentation and plans.
  • Support internal teams in identifying risks and developing mitigation strategies related to operational disruptions.

Corporate Security & Risk Policies

  • Assist with the development, documentation, and implementation of corporate security policies and procedures.
  • Support initiatives designed to strengthen enterprise risk awareness and risk management practices across the organization.
  • Ensure risk management activities align with internal policies, procedures, and governance frameworks.

HNI Corporation (NYSE: HNI) is a manufacturer of workplace furnishings and building products, operating under two segments. The workplace furnishings segment is a leading global designer and provider of commercial furnishings, going to market under multiple unique brands. The residential building products segment is the nation's leading manufacturer and marketer of hearth products.
